1U rack-mount version of the SSL G Series console master bus compressor utilizing SuperAnalogue design topology MFR# 729946X2 Product Description The SSL XLogic G-Series Stereo Compressor puts the iconic sound of the legendary SL 4000 G-Series console bus compressor right in your studio rack. The SSL XLogic G Series Stereo Compressor combines the classic SSL G Series center compressor design with next-generation SuperAnalogue technology for unparalleled audio performance. LEGENDARY DESIGNRevered for its punchy, open sound, The SL 4000 console and its legendary center section compressor have been used to mix countless hit records. Known as the ultimate mix bus compressor for its ability to seamlessly glue tracks together, the SSL bus compressor is still a favorite amongst top-tier audio engineers. The SSL XLogic G Series Stereo Compressor takes that classic sound to a whole new level with next-generation SuperAnalogue technology for improved depth and clarity. Dial in everything from massive, exciting drum sounds to thick, rich vocal tones and big, fat bass tracks. Of course, the SSL bus compressor still sounds great on the mix bus too!UPDATED CONTROLSThe SSL XLogic G Series Stereo Compressor utilizes the same iconic design as the original SL 4000 console, with a few new tweaks for added versatility.The attack controls now offer six positions for a wider range of options. Choose from 0.1 ms, .3 ms, 1 ms, 3 ms, 10 ms, and 30 ms. Similarly, the release settings now include 0.1 sec, 0.3 sec, 0.6 sec, 1.2 sec and the dynamic AUTO setting. Use the classic 2:1, 4:1 and 10:1 ratio settings to dial in everything from smooth, subtle compression to hyper-aggressive limiting. The original Auto Fade button can be used to smoothly fade out of a song for subtle outros.The SSL XLogic G Series Stereo Compressor also includes a dedicated Side-Chain Input button, enabling advanced compression techniques like side-chain compression or 80s-style gated-reverbs. Threshold. It allows you to modify the contrast between background material (under threshold) and forward material (above threshold). The D-EQ is built upon a specially adapted version of the Bus Compressor side-chain circuit, which contributes significantly to its powerful, yet musical sonic character. Being able to use the D-EQ in conjunction with The Bus Compressor makes for some very exciting dynamic and tonal options indeed. To round off the design, we decided to give The Bus+ 4 unique operating modes. Alongside the known and loved Classic Stereo mode, a S/C Stereo mode is available, as found in our Duality console. Mid Side allows you to tailor the final mix/master stereo image and Dual Mono is super useful for tracking purposes or creative stem use. The Bus+ is truly a treasure chest of compression options at your disposal. Solo Level, Solo Clear and Red Light Switch complete the available options.Mix Bus - The mix bus features a high-quality 100mm fader, with fully balanced switched Insert for external bus processing.Monitoring - The monitoring section features independent Trims for Alternate Monitors 1 & 2, variable DIM level, MONO plus Left & Right MUTES and øL polarity switch. You can select your monitor source from the main mix, three external stereo sources or a front panel stereo 3.5mm jack input, with a Sum switch allowing selected sources to be listened to simultaneously.Returns - Four Stereo Return Inputs enable ORIGIN to route to Mix and Track Buses with level controlled feeds to Stereo Foldback Outputs A & B.Classic SSL InnovationE-Series '242' EQThe E-Series '242' EQ was probably the most popular EQ from the SL 4000 series console range, and it's back for ORIGIN, which uses this iconic SSL design for it's channel EQ.ORIGIN features the acclaimed E-Series four-band parametric EQ on each of its 32-channels, with variable Cut/Boost per band, HF and LF Bell/Shelf switches, independent sweepable HPF on every channel and unmistakable '242' style growl and deep low end.PureDrive™ORIGIN features a completely new microphone pre-amplifier design that inherits the clarity and purity of previous SSL mic pre's, with the added flexibility of switching character to a warm, harmonically-rich and driven tone that varies with gain. The ideal solution to 'perfect' digital system and hybrid workflow.PureDrive™ is a new discrete transistor mic-pre based around modern FET components. The result is an ultra-clean, ultra-low noise pre amp, that is fast and offers stunning resolution when in 'Pure' mode.
